Unlike traditional banks, online banks are able to do away with fees because they don’t have to charge their clients to pay for overhead costs (like physical branches, which require rent, utilities, maintenance, and employee hours, for example). 1. Ally Bank
Ally Bank’s interest checking account made our list of the best online checking accounts of 2020. However, aside from offering high interest rates for checking accounts, 0.50% APY on their savings accounts, and great savings tools connected to their mobile app, the bank is well-known in the “no-fee” world of banking for offering $0 in monthly maintenance fees.
Furthermore, those looking for a low barrier of entry will enjoy the fact that Ally doesn’t require a minimum balance to open an account with them. Where Ally does charge fees, though, is for overdrafts and wire transfers. Check out Ally Bank’s online account fees below:
💸 Minimum Opening Balance: $0
😢 Overdraft Fee: $25
💲 Other Fees: Ally reimburses up to $10 at the end of each statement cycle for fees charged at other ATMs nationwide; no fees for incoming wires; outgoing domestic wires are $20
2. Discover
Discover Bank is a pretty widely-used online bank, but most people seem to think of Discover as a credit card company. They actually have other accounts available, including a great cashback debit card! They offer credit cards, personal loans, home loans, and even student loans. Other reasons users love Discover Bank aside from their no-fee commitment is the fact that they, like Ally, offer low minimum requirements to open a bank account (both checking and savings), and they also don’t charge ATM fees.
Those interested in a no-fee debit card might want to check out the Discover Cashback Debit, which earns 1.15% APY (up to $30 per month). It’s worth noting, though, that you also have to open a Discover Online Savings account in order to have the cashback savings sent there.
💸 Minimum Opening Balance: $0
😢 Overdraft Fee: $0
💲 Other Fees: $0 in ATM fees at over 60,000 ATMs nationwide; incoming wire transfers are free; outgoing wire transfers are $30
3. Axos Bank
Axos Bank easily makes our list of the best no-fee online banks of 2021, mostly for their ATM refund policies and the high APY they offer for their savings accounts (it goes up to an impressive 0.61%). However, you do have to have over $1,000 in direct deposits a month to qualify for those kinds of rates.
Like most other online banks, their fee-free banking option is a fantastic benefit for those who simply want to save money and earn cashback on their purchases, and we love that there aren’t any hidden fees when signing up for or using their accounts.
💸 Minimum Opening Balance: $0
😢 Overdraft Fee: N/A
💲 Other Fees: Unlimited domestic ATM fee reimbursements
4. Varo
If you’re looking for a no-fee online bank that offers incredibly high APY on savings account options, check out Varo. Their savings account APYs go all the way up to 2.80% in some instances, and the interest is compounded daily instead of monthly. On top of the high interest rates, you can expect to enjoy no foreign transaction fees, no hidden fees, and no fees when withdrawing money a 55,000 ATMs nationwide.
Are there any drawbacks to this no-fee bank? Some, yeah. There are fees on cash deposits (about $5 per transaction), and there is no Zelle incorporation like some other online banks. This means that transferring money from your Varo account to friends or family with other banks might be a little more difficult.
💸 Minimum Opening Balance: $0
😢 Overdraft Fee: $0 (if you overdraft up to $50)
💲 Other Fees: No ATM fees at Allpoint ATMs in the United States; currently there are no wire transfers, both domestic and international, are currently unavailable with Varo Bank
